TD Garden isn’t just a place where Boston’s sports history lives; it’s the heartbeat of the city during those intense NBA Eastern Conference Finals games, especially when the Celtics are in the mix. This arena has seen it all, from the Bruins honoring Jeremy Jacobs in a touching ceremony to the Celtics celebrating their 1969 championship with a halftime tribute that still gives fans chills. Opened back in 1995 as the FleetCenter and rebranded in 2005, TD Garden has become a fortress for Boston sports fans, a place where the energy is electric and every seat feels like the best seat in the house. Whether you’re grabbing tickets in the First Level to really feel part of the action or enjoying the perks of premium seats with early access and exclusive gear, there’s nothing quite like being here when Boston is fighting for a shot at the conference title. Getting to the Garden is a breeze too, exit I-93 at Government Center or take the T from nearby stations, and you’re practically at the doorstep. It’s more than just a venue, it’s where memories are made, rivalries are born, and Boston’s sports legacy is celebrated every season.
